Using the vocab provided translate the sentence below into Latin

The gods were calling the women to the temple. god = deus, dei; call = voco (1); woman = femina, feminae; to = ad + accusative; temple = templum, templi.
Dei vocabant feminas ad templum

At the shop, Max buys 5 juice boxes and 12 sweets which costs him £1.34 in total. If x represents the cost of one juice box (in pence) and y represents the cost of one sweet (in pence), write out an equation, in terms of x and y, to show this

5x + 12y = 134
